Features

  • 24/7 Performance: With sufficient sunlight, the Aiper Surfer S2 Robotic Solar Pool Skimmer's solar charging ensures 24/7 cleaning. On cloudy days, a single charge via the DC adapter can keep your skimmer running for up to 35 hours
  • Efficient Cleaning with Adjustable Chlorine Dispenser: Aiper Surfer S2's industry-leading 150-micron filtration and DebrisGuard anti-leak design effectively capture all kinds of debris. It holds 3-inch chlorine tablets for consistently cleaner water
  • The App Just Got Smarter: Now you can start or stop your device, set custom cleaning schedules, steer remotely, track progress, view history, and get instant blocking alerts!
  • Obstacle Avoidance & Edge Cleaning: Dual sensors and Aiper's Smart Algorithms enable effective obstacle avoidance and precise cleaning, even on hard-to-reach edges and corners of your pool
  • Anti-Stuck Design: Equipped with four retractable anti-stranding columns, the Surfer S2 avoids getting stuck on pool steps, paired with the obstruction alert through the app, ensuring uninterrupted operation and continuous cleaning
  • Durable & Weather Resistant: Built with UV-resistant materials, the Aiper Surfer S2 is designed to withstand harsh weather conditions and comes with 24-month product care ensuring long-lasting performance
  • Precautions: Foam noodle (W/Orange) included in box or filter basket. Remove if in basket to avoid affecting normal operation; place in skimmer port to prevent being stuck(This product is not suitable for infinity pools)

  • Yes, it can work along with a Polaris pressure side hose pool cleaner! Yes, it can work along with a Polaris pressure side hose pool cleaner!
Color: Gray
This thing works great! And yes, it works with a Polaris pressure side hose cleaner, which most people say can't work. I was out for an evening swim, when some lights reflected on the water surface, revealing all kinds of things floating around: tiny bugs, pollen/dust, flower petals, etc. It seems that every one of my neighbors has a crepe myrtle tree with petals that blow into our pool. I didn't like the idea of swimming around in all of that stuff. So I started searching for a skimmer. I figure a skimmer can trap debris before it has time to sink to the bottom, also making things easier on the Polaris. But, all the reviews said you couldn't use a solar skimmer along with a hose cleaner. I saw someone mention adding weights to the hose, but I had an idea. I debated between the Aiper and the Bette skimmer, but I like the idea of having an app, with a scheduler, in case I need to schedule around the hose cleaner or something. I went ahead and ordered the Aiper Surfer S2. Cheaper than the Bette at the time. It arrived. I linked the app, set it in the water and turned it on. It ran around doing its thing. Awesome. But then, it got to the hose and got stuck. Just like they said. I tried scheduling the skimmer to turn off for an hour so the hose cleaner could run. But the hose cleaner would surround the skimmer and they'd both get stuck. I thought about alternating, like pulling the Polaris out and dropping it in as needed. Or letting it run, and only putting the skimmer in as needed. But I really liked the idea of the skimmer running 24/7, and the Polaris running for an hour every day. So I experimented. SOLUTION! The solution turned out to be pretty easy. I simply removed almost all of the hose floats. I removed 6 of them. There are now only 3. There's one on the section of hose coming from the side of the pool. There's one on the 2nd hose section. And there's one on the 3rd section, right above the rescue valve. That 3rd float stays submerged and only helps the valve stay out of the way of the cleaner. Only 2 floats are actually on the surface. I made sure the 1st section, coming from the wall, stays slightly higher in the water than the 2nd section. And of course the 3rd section goes down to the cleaner. Think of each section of hose as kind of "draping" into the water, but not reaching the bottom. There are now only 2 floats at the surface, and the hose drops away on both sides of each float at a sharp angle. I had to get into the water and just slide the floats until I got them the way I wanted. Now, the skimmer glides over the hoses without touching them at all. If it runs into one of the 2 floats, it gently powers over them. The floats are kind of held down by the weight of the hoses, so they are easy for the skimmer to push over. See video. End result is that my pool looks INCREDIBLE now. The bottom surface is spotless, as it gets cleaned for an hour every day. And the Polaris makes good use of the hour, by not getting stuck, and by having a Zipper closure on the bag. It actually cleans, instead of just looking busy. (Our old Pentair Racer looked busy but kept sticking in the corners and blowing debris straight out of the velcro opening.) The Aiper skimmer runs 24/7 on the surface. It doesn't have a set pattern or mapping, but it is relentless and tireless! No bugs, no pollen, no crepe myrtle petals can hide forever. The water shimmers and is clear from the top surface, through the middle, all the way down to the bottom. It really looks incredible. We keep staring at it in wonder. It is that noticeable. And when I went out for an evening swim, the water was like it just poured out of a filtered pitcher. Get one of these skimmers. If you have a hose cleaner, remove most of the floats. Enjoy crystal clear water. Note: In the video, I still had 4 floats, not 3. I later removed one more float that was not needed, so only 3 floats remain. This video should give you a good idea of how it is setup, and how easily the skimmer can push over a hose float, so long as you remove most of them. ... show more

  • Good but not wonderful--need patience
Color: Gray
Update-7-25-25-- After about two months... I'm raising the rating to four stars from three for two reasons: 1.Aiper customer service reached out and was very proactive in trying to make me happy and resolve my problem with the unit. 2. I understand better that to get a 60x15 pool you have to be very patient, as in very, very patient, like minimum 2 hours, better 3 hours with the pool filter, in my case, no more than 50% power. It will then pick up a good 85%-90% of bugs and stuff. It's what one could call "a process." For these reasons, I figure it's closer to four starts that three. Really about 3.5 stars. Having used this for more than a month in our 60' lap pool, there are ups and downs, much like life itself. The pros: --After charging via plug once, never have had to do it again. The solar panel keeps the battery charged at +/- 90%. --Of given enough time, it will pick up everything in its path. --Cleaning the unit is very easy and trouble free, as advertised. --The App is handy, with caveats (see below). Cons: --The sensors in front of the unit are only meant to steer it away from some obstructions. The big problem from my POV is that the skimmer turns from the pool wall about a foot away, much of the time. It also avoids corners. Unfortunately, these are where, by some law of physics, dead bugs and flies favor. --As noted above, given enough time, the surfer will pick up everything in its random path--and the path is totally random. It's the 50% of dead bugs and stuff along the wall edges and corners that are problematic. --The skimmer's path is affected by things like the breeze and strength of the pool filter. Instructions recommend running the skimmer when the pool filter is turned off. That's not practical, at least not in my pool. I found it to be more or less useless if the filter pump is turned on more than 50%. --Also, because my pool uses a Polaris 280 with boost pump, the Polaris and its feeder hose must be removed before putting the skimmer in the water. Otherwise the skimmer will become entangled in the Polaris' hose, every time, guaranteed. --At times I swear the skimmer consciously avoids stuff, turning aside at the last moment or navigating between two dead bugs and picking up neither. But that can't be, right? --Though the app provides for manual control, response is sticky at best. Sort of like trying to turn the queen mary around in a bathtub. --A final note, if your coping extends beyond the pool wall more than about half an inch, the unit will get scraped: when our pool was built, schist was selected instead of tile or bluestone for the coping. However, what makes schist attractive is its natural look and feel. The schist slabs have uneven "live" edges, not square cut like tiles or bluestone. While unique and beautiful, the result is the schist overhangs the edge of our pool by about a half an inch or so. While the skimmer has bumper wheels below the water surface to keep it from hitting the wall, they do not extend out enough to prevent the unit from scraping itself along the exposed schist. Conclusions: 1. While I appreciate the tech involved and the fact that it does, eventually, pick up 80%-90% of the floating stuff, knowing what I know now, I'd wait for improvements in the technology that would allow it to cruise closer to pool walls, operate in a programmed path, like a better robot floor vacuum, and is more responsive when using the remote. ... show more

  • Spectacular Performance Polishing Water
Color: Gray
I bought this product to grab leaves floating on the surface of my in-ground pool, before they could sink and get sucked up by my vacuum-based bottom cleaner. It certainly performed that function extremely well. What I didn't realize was that my pool surface also had a persistent layer of dust, pollen, and other urban gunk that made the surface look dull. This cleaner also removed that layer, making the water look spectacularly polished. I was doubly impressed and set my review at five stars. The packaging was top notch, and the provided phone app was well thought out and worked perfectly. Given this level of satisfaction, I found myself doubly disappointed when the left of two propellers stopped working in less than a year. I swapped propellers, but the problem stayed on the left. Each propeller snaps onto an axle assembly that has a cable routed into a waterproof box housing the control electronics. I opened up the electronics box and saw cable connectors that allowed me to swap left and right axle assemblies, and the problem stayed on the left. This told me the problem was with the axle assembly, not the electronics. Thinking that I could never get replacement parts, I lowered my review to just one star, thinking it was game over for the Aiper. Well, stay tuned. Shortly thereafter, I was contacted by Aiper who asked for additional information, and they concluded the best path forward was to give me a completely new unit. This told me two things about Aiper: (1) they monitor reviews to access customer satisfaction, and (2) they go the extra mile to make sure customers are satisfied. Because of that outstanding customer support, I have restored my review to five stars. The new unit arrived in just a few days, and it is busy restoring that polished look to my pool surface. One other hint for those who might have a bottom vacuum cleaner with a long floating hose like I do: My Aiper liked the hose, and they developed a relationship that interfered with efficiency. I got some 14-gauge stainless steel wire and wrapped it into the spiral of the hose in three places along its length (about 10 wraps each). This sank the hose a bit, making it look like the Lock Ness monster that breaks the surface just here and there. The Aiper and the hose now play nice together. ... show more
